Pemberwick Dam

Pemberwick Dam is a concrete dam located in Fairfield County, Connecticut, built in 1867. It carries a High hazard potential classification and has a fair condition assessment.

About Pemberwick Dam

The primary purpose of Pemberwick Dam is recreation. The dam creates a reservoir used for recreational activities such as fishing, boating, and swimming. The dam is owned by Waterfall Hollow Of Greenwich Llc (private). It impounds the Byram River near Pemberwick.

The dam stands 44 feet tall and stretches 115 feet across, creates a reservoir covering 5 acres, has a maximum storage capacity of 60 acre-feet, and collects water from a drainage area of 25 square miles. Completed in 1867, the structure is one of the older dams in the region, with over a century and a half of service.

This dam carries a high hazard potential classification, which means that a failure or uncontrolled release of water would likely cause loss of human life. This classification reflects the consequences of failure, not the likelihood — it indicates that people live or work in the area downstream. Its condition is rated fair — the dam has minor deficiencies that are being addressed or do not pose an immediate safety threat. Notably, no emergency action plan is currently on file for this high-hazard dam. The most recent inspection on record was 03/07/2023.

At 44 feet, this dam is taller than 90% of dams nationwide.
